At its core, the blockchain wealth formula begins with understanding the fundamental pillars of blockchain technology itself. Think of blockchain as a distributed, immutable ledger that records transactions across a network of computers. This decentralization is paramount. Instead of a single point of control, data is shared and validated by many, making it incredibly resistant to fraud, censorship, and single points of failure. This inherent security and transparency form the bedrock upon which wealth can be built. When you invest in or utilize blockchain-based assets, you're investing in a system that operates with unprecedented levels of trust, a crucial element often missing in traditional financial systems.

The third pillar is Programmability and Smart Contracts. Blockchain technology isn't just about recording transactions; it's about enabling automated agreements. Smart contracts are self-executing contracts with the terms of the agreement directly written into code. They automatically execute when predefined conditions are met, eliminating the need for intermediaries and reducing the potential for disputes. Think of it as a digital vending machine: you put in your money, you select your item, and the machine automatically dispenses it. In the context of wealth, smart contracts can automate processes like dividend payouts, royalty distributions, and escrow services, streamlining operations and unlocking new investment opportunities. This programmability allows for innovative financial instruments and services that can generate passive income and enhance returns.

The first practical application of the Blockchain Wealth Formula is Strategic Investment in Digital Assets. This goes beyond simply buying and holding cryptocurrencies. It involves understanding different asset classes within the blockchain ecosystem. C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in and Ethereum serve as foundational digital currencies and store-of-value assets. However, the landscape has expanded dramatically. Stablecoins offer a less volatile entry point, pegged to fiat currencies, providing stability for transactions and savings. Utility tokens grant access to specific services or networks, while governance tokens give holders a say in the future development of decentralized projects. Furthermore, Non-Fungible Tokens (NFTs) have opened up new avenues for owning unique digital or even physical assets, from art and music to virtual real estate. The key to strategic investment is diversification, thorough research into project fundamentals, and an understanding of market dynamics. This isn't about chasing the latest hype; it's about identifying projects with real-world utility, strong development teams, and sustainable tokenomics that align with long-term value creation.

Secondly, the formula emphasizes Leveraging Decentralized Finance (DeFi). DeFi represents a parallel financial system built on blockchain, offering services like lending, borrowing, trading, and yield generation without traditional financial institutions. Imagine earning interest on your crypto holdings at rates often significantly higher than traditional savings accounts, or borrowing assets with your crypto as collateral. Platforms utilizing smart contracts facilitate these operations, offering transparency and efficiency. Yield farming, liquidity providing, and staking are popular DeFi strategies that can generate passive income. However, DeFi also carries risks, including smart contract vulnerabilities, impermanent loss in liquidity pools, and market volatility. Therefore, a component of the Blockchain Wealth Formula is learning to navigate these risks through careful selection of platforms, understanding the underlying mechanisms, and managing your risk exposure.

The Power of Biometrics

At the heart of this revolution lies biometrics—a field that leverages unique biological traits like fingerprints, iris patterns, and facial features to verify identity. Biometrics provide an unparalleled level of security compared to traditional methods such as passwords and PINs. In healthcare, this translates to a new era of secure patient identification and data protection. With biometrics, healthcare providers can ensure that patient records are accessed only by authorized personnel, significantly reducing the risk of data breaches and unauthorized access.

Web3: The Decentralized Future

Web3, the next evolution of the internet, emphasizes decentralization, user control, and the use of blockchain technology. In healthcare, Web3's decentralized nature allows for a more transparent and secure management of patient data. Blockchain, a core component of Web3, ensures that medical records are immutable and transparent, allowing patients to have full control over their health data while still maintaining privacy and security.
